The AirTAC SDA80X90B is a double-acting single-rod compact cylinder engineered to deliver a robust 2513.3 N push force at 0.5 MPa. By utilizing a riveted assembly that permanently joins the barrel, rear cover, piston, and rod, this unit achieves an exceptionally short axial profile. This space-saving footprint is critical for machinery where a conventional round-body actuator would protrude too far into the work envelope.
This specific SKU is configured with a male M22x1.5 piston rod thread (denoted by the B option code) for secure mechanical coupling to your tooling. The 80 mm bore necessitates PT3/8 air ports and carries a 25 mm rod diameter to handle high thrust loads. Deceleration at the stroke extremes relies on a fixed NBR bumper rather than an adjustable air cushion, meaning operators should incorporate external shock absorbers if cycling at the maximum 500 mm/s speed.

Drives heavy ejector pins on large plastic injection molding machines, utilizing the 3518.6 N extend force at 0.7 MPa to break parts free from deep cavities.
Actuates hold-down clamps on an automated press brake, where the male M22x1.5 rod end secures custom tooling and the compact body minimizes machine footprint.
Provides the vertical lifting thrust for heavy product diverters on palletizing conveyors, moving loads safely within the 128.1 kg vertical lift margin.
When sizing this 80 mm bore actuator, evaluate your thrust requirements carefully. Stepping down to the SDA63 yields 1558.6 N of push force at 0.5 MPa, whereas stepping up to the SDA100 provides 3927 N. For the SDA80X90B, the computed safe working load is approximately 1508 N (about 60 percent of the 0.5 MPa rating), translating to a vertical lift capacity of roughly 128.1 kg with a 2:1 safety margin. Ensure your ordering essentials match this configuration: an 80 mm bore, 90 mm stroke, PT3/8 ports, a male M22x1.5 rod end, and no piston magnet. Because this is a standard double-acting cylinder, it will not hold a load if air pressure drops or the valve is centered—the piston will drift, as the fixed NBR bumper only decelerates the stroke end rather than locking it. To suspend a load safely without live pressure, integrate an external rod lock or a pilot-operated check valve.

This 80 mm bore double-acting cylinder generates 2513.3 N push and 2267.8 N pull at 0.5 MPa, and 3518.6 N push at 0.7 MPa. The theoretical maximum push force is 513 kgf at 1.0 MPa. It operates on filtered air between 0.15 and 1.0 MPa, with a proof pressure of 1.5 MPa.
This specific SKU lacks a piston magnet, so it cannot accept AirTAC reed or electronic switches. End-of-stroke deceleration is handled by a fixed NBR bumper, not a field-adjustable air cushion; for high-energy cycles, add external shock absorbers.
